Choosing the Ideal Fluoride Removal System

With growing awareness of potential health concerns related to elevated fluoride levels in tap water, many homeowners are investigating fluoride removal systems. Nevertheless, navigating the intricate world of filtration options can be daunting. Several methods are available, each with its distinct pros and cons. Granular filters are a popular choice, effectively reducing fluoride alongside other contaminants. Reverse osmosis (RO) systems offer a greater degree of fluoride elimination, but can also lead to wastewater production. Lastly, fluoride binding media, such as aluminum oxide, provide another feasible solution. The optimal system for your home depends on factors like budget, water quality, and desired fluoride concentration. Think about a professional water analysis and discuss with a water filtration specialist to make an informed decision.

Defluoridation: Ensuring Your Water Source

Excessive fluoride in your water can pose serious health risks, particularly for youngsters. Defluoridation, the technique of lowering fluoride levels, is becoming increasingly critical for many communities around the globe. Various approaches, such as activated aluminum oxide and membrane filtration, can be employed to effectively cleanse polluted water. Choosing the right defluoridation solution depends on factors like H2O properties, budget, and expected performance. Investing in defluoridation is an commitment in community well-being and a responsible future.
